Nols sits down with Colin B Osborn to talk going punk to poetry.
Osborn poetry navigates the landscapes of personal history and keen observation with a lyrical and accessible style. These poems are a testament to self-discovery, celebrating the moments—both quiet and profound—where we define our own narratives. For lovers of contemporary poetry that is both thoughtful and resonant, is a compelling and masterful first outing from a promising new voice.

Colin is co-founder of POW play on words which have two events this month. Including Pertinent Interruptions on the 19th December 2025 - a night of heckling at the open mic.
Colin and Nols are working with Rich Bliss, Redeeming Features and Im Not Leaving yet are raising money for MIND on the 29th January 2026 at the Fiddler's Elbow with a show called THROW WORDS DOWN where poets and anyone can get 3 minutes on stage with a hardcore band and scream their guts out.
